Description
Original era manufacture. Brightly polished steel 31 inch blade maker marked by Klingenthal on the blade spine. Scattered areas of corrosion staining and a bit of pitting near the tip, few nail catchers along the cutting edge. Brass guard with a floral pattern below the pommel. Fishskin wrapped grip shows wear, twisted wire binding is intact. In 1850 the US Army adopted a new Foot Officers sword which is nearly identical to this pattern sword. No scabbard.
